A tour of southern Greenland

New international airport in Nuuk has given this 'bucolic' island a welcome boost

Nuuk, Greenland
Nuuk: an excellent introduction to the island's culture and history
(Image credit: James Brooks / AFP / Getty Images)

Greenland has been in the spotlight this year thanks to Donald Trump's "scandalising designs" on its mineral resources.

But the vast Arctic island has also had a more welcome boost, said Henry Wismayer in the Financial Times – the opening of an international airport in its capital, Nuuk. Until now, most visitors flew in to a remote former US air base 200 miles away, and many never got to see this striking harbour town.
